Round Brush

Let’s start with a classic: the round brush. This isn’t just any brush; its barrel size and bristle type are designed for lift. When you pair a round brush with your blow dryer, you can pull sections of hair up and away from the scalp. This technique creates lift right at the roots, which is the foundation for any voluminous look.

Blow Dryer

Next up is the blow dryer itself, specifically one with a concentrator nozzle. This attachment directs the airflow for more precise styling. To get maximum volume, flip your hair upside down and dry it until it’s about 80% dry. Then, flip your hair back and use the round brush and nozzle to smooth and shape the ends. Hot Rollers

Hot rollers are another fantastic option for creating lasting volume and soft curls. After you heat them up, roll sections of your hair and secure them with clips. Let them cool completely before you take them out. The heat reshapes the hair, and the cooling period sets the style for all-day body.

Root-Lifting Iron/Crimper

For a more modern approach, a root-lifting iron or a crimper can work wonders. These tools create a hidden texture close to the scalp. You just crimp the under-layers of your hair near the roots. The top layers of hair will lay smoothly over this textured base, which gives an instant, durable lift.

Tease Comb

Finally, a good old-fashioned tease comb can provide a quick boost. The fine teeth of the comb are perfect for backcombing small sections of hair at the crown. A gentle backcomb builds a cushion of hair at the root, which gives the appearance of more thickness.
